Edward Marshall Michael SIMMONS

Regimental number10351
Place of birthCamaru, New Zealand
SchoolChristian Brothers' Catholic School, South Melbourne, Victoria
ReligionRoman Catholic
OccupationMechanic
Address411 King Street, West Melbourne, Victoria
Marital statusSingle
Age at embarkation37
Next of kinSister, Mrs Annie Andrews, 62 Brewer Street, East Perth, Western Australia
Enlistment date5 February 1916
Rank on enlistmentSapper
Unit name10th Field Company Engineers
AWM Embarkation Roll number14/29/1
Embarkation detailsUnit embarked from Melbourne, Victoria, on board HMAT A54 Runic on 20 June 1916
Rank from Nominal RollLance Corporal
Unit from Nominal Roll10th Field Company Engineers
FateKilled in Action 7 June 1917
Miscellaneous details (Nominal Roll)*Given name Edward Marshall
Place of death or woundingMessines, Belgium
Age at death37
Age at death from cemetery records37
Place of burialStrand Military Cemetery (Plot IV, Row A, Grave No. 12), Ploegsteert, Belgium

Parents: Marshall and Margaret SIMMONS. Native of Omaru, New Zealand
Family/military connectionsNephew: Private A.L. Callander who died of wounds on 19 October 1917.
